António José Ribeiro Saramago was born in Vila Nogueira de Azeitão in 1948, and from a very early age he demonstrated a passion for the world of wine, with the influence of his father, José Maria Saramago, winemaker at the José Maria da Fonseca company for 42 years. With more than 200 awards won, many of his wines have been highly appreciated by the national and international specialty press, with Jancis Robinson and Robert Parker standing out in the latter.
